Katherine R. Russell
Hi! I am a fourth-year graduate student in the Linguistics Department at UC Berkeley. My research interests center on phonology and its interfaces with morphology and syntax, particularly in West African languages. I'm a recipient of the NSF GRFP. Before coming to Berkeley, I graduated from Georgetown University with a BA in linguistics and minor in Turkish.
